Abstract
The stage of a turbine or of a compressor having a plurality of blades which are mounted on a rotor and/or a stator of the stage. The blades are combined into a number of blade clusters as integral components which are each composed of at least two blades and which are each equipped with one shared blade mount for mounting the cluster on the rotor or stator.

9 . A stage of a turbine or of a compressor comprising:
a rotor or stator; blades mounted on the rotor or stator, the blades being combined into a number of blade clusters as integral components each composed of at least two blades, each blade cluster equipped with one shared blade mount for mounting the blade cluster on the rotor or stator.
10 . The stage as recited in claim 9 wherein the blade mount includes an axially extending dovetail groove or tongue for connection to a corresponding dovetail tongue or groove, respectively, on the rotor or stator.
11 . The stage as recited in claim 10 wherein the dovetail connection is configured in a decentralized location between the at least two blades.
12 . The stage as recited in claim 11 wherein the dovetail connection is offset circumferentially from a central location between the at least two blades.
13 . The stage as recited in claim 12 wherein the circumferential offset is equal to approximately one half of a blade pitch, the direction of the offset corresponding to the direction of the action of force of the blades.
14 . The stage as recited in claim 9 wherein the blade mount is the dovetail groove formed on the blade cluster, and the corresponding tongue is formed on the rotor or stator.
15 . The stage as recited in claim 8 wherein each blade cluster has three blades.
16 . The stage as recited in claim 14 wherein the corresponding tongues are formed in one piece with the rotor or the stator.
